Drexelbrook Sensor As Found Manufacturers Test Terminal Functional Testing
Purpose of Test
To verify the SIF operates correctly prior to any disturbance.
SIF is SENSOR ELEMENT trips & inhibits the FINAL ELEMENT(s) to the safe state as specified.
Method of activation is by operation of the manufacturers test facility
To verify the correct DIAGNOSTICS information.
If this test is not performed ‘as found’ undetected faults may not be revealed.
If sensing element defective the tank could overfill if a demand is made on the overfill protection
system.
If response target time is exceeded the tank could overfill following demand.
Diagnostic information not displayed correctly could result in undetected tank overfill, system
unavailability or incorrect operational response.
